The Fourth Walsh- Recommended
"...Created and directed by Neil Goldberg, HOLIDAZE is a playful diddie that combines Dickens, the North Pole and winter deity into a big box of Christmas fun. Goldberg keeps it simple making it truly kid-friendly. He doesn’t focus on a story. Instead, Goldberg utilizes a large cast of ornaments to provide a series of wonderland numbers. The thirty member ensemble, many playing multiple parts, add plenty of glitter and sparkle."
